Choosing the Right Professional Roofing Services

Evaluating Your Roofing Needs

Before initiating any roofing project, it’s crucial to evaluate your specific needs. Consider the following steps:

  • Assess the Condition of Your Roof: Identify visible signs of damage or wear, such as leaks, missing tiles, or significant wear and tear.
  • Determine Your Budget: Understanding your financial constraints helps in selecting appropriate materials and services without overspending.
  • Set a Timeline: Establish when you need the work completed to ensure the project fits within your expectations.

Factors to Consider When Selecting a Contractor

When choosing a roofing contractor, consider the following factors to ensure you make an informed decision:

  • Licensing and Insurance: Ensure the contractor is licensed and possesses adequate insurance, including liability and worker’s compensation, to protect against potential accidents.
  • Reputation and Reviews: Research the contractor’s history and reputation. Testimonials and reviews from previous customers can provide insight into their reliability and quality of work.
  • Experience: Contractors with years of experience have likely encountered various challenges and can offer effective solutions.
  • Written Estimates: A professional contractor provides clear, detailed written estimates that outline the scope of work and the materials to be used.

Questions to Ask Before Hiring

Before hiring a roofing contractor, consider asking the following questions:

  • What types of roofing materials do you recommend, and why?
  • Can you provide references from past clients?
  • What is your projected timeline for completion?
  • How do you handle unexpected expenses or changes in the project scope?
  • What warranties do you offer on your materials and services?

Maintaining Your Roof After Professional Roofing Services

Regular Maintenance Tips for Longevity

To ensure your roof remains in optimal condition, consider implementing these regular maintenance tips:

  • Schedule annual inspections with a professional to identify potential issues early.
  • Keep gutters and downspouts clean and clear to prevent water damage.
  • Trim overhanging branches to prevent them from damaging your roof during storms.
  • Check for signs of moss or algae growth and remove them as needed.

Signs Your Roof Needs Attention

Be aware of the following signs that may indicate your roof requires immediate attention:

  • Visible sagging or warping.
  • Water stains or damp spots on ceilings or walls.
  • Missing or damaged shingles or tiles.
  • Excessive granule loss in gutters or on the ground around your home.

Emergency Service Protocols

In the event of an emergency, such as a leak caused by storm damage, it’s essential to know the protocols:

  • Contact your roofing contractor immediately if significant damage occurs.
  • Document damage for insurance purposes with photographs and notes.
  • Minimize further damage by moving valuables away from affected areas and using buckets to collect water if leaks occur.

Cost Considerations for Professional Roofing Services

Understanding Pricing Models and Estimates

The cost of professional roofing services can vary significantly based on numerous factors, including:

  • Size and complexity of the roof.
  • Type of materials chosen for the project.
  • Labor costs based on location and contractor experience.
  • Extent of repairs needed or special features (like skylights or solar panels).

Hidden Costs to Be Aware Of

When budgeting for roofing services, consider potential hidden costs that may arise:

  • Permits and inspections required by local governments.
  • Upgrades or improvements that may be necessary during the installation process.
  • Costs for removing old roofing materials if replacing an existing roof.
